Synopsis: This work is an introduction to one of Britain's best-known writers, which guides the reader through the novels, tracing basic patterns which run throughout Murdoch's work and showing how the novels help to elucidate one another. This new edition takes into account certain details which have emerged following Murdoch's death in 1999 and is revised and updated throughout, incorporating the latest scholarship. It also features an examination of Murdoch's last published novel, "Jackson's Dilemma".
